South Portland man drowns in Saco River

Police say a man from South Portland drowned in the Saco River on Sunday.

Buxton police said 38-year-old Abiodun Jerry Roland Olubi fell into the river at Pleasant Point Park in Buxton Sunday afternoon. A woman witnessed the accident and told police the man had fallen into the water off of a slippery rock outcrop, and that she didn’t believe he knew how to swim.

Search and rescue personnel checked the water and found Olubi’s body at a depth of about 50 feet.

Police remind the public that the Saco River is very deep in that area. They called the incident a “tragic accident” and expressed their condolences to the family.
